In the early 2010s, legal crackdowns—most notably the seizure of Megaupload in 2012—led to the shutdown of dozens of major hosting sites. Millions of terabytes of independent films, rare music, and subculture documentaries vanished overnight, creating a massive gap in digital history known to archivists as a "digital dark age" for mid-2000s media.
